A Track Record of Service
The Ratanak Foundation is a federally incorporated Canadian charity dedicated to the assistance of the Cambodian people (We are presently seeking to move towards charitable status in the UK).
The following projects were funded by the Ratanak Foundation and implemented through international and local NGO's (Non-Government Organizations) under existing Memorandums of Understanding with the applicable Cambodian Government Ministries.
1991
- Shipment and presentation of $100,000 of medical supplies to Dr. Hong Theme, Vice Minister, Ministry of Health, Phnom Penh.
1992
- Building water system, Kampong Cham Provincial hospital.
1992-1997
- Building Sangkar District Hospital, Battambang.
- Building Sangkar District clinics, Roka, Wat Tamim, Odam Bang II.
- Building TB ward, Sangkar District Hospital.
- Renovation Sangkar District clinics, Reang Kesai, Kampong Prieng and Kampong Preah.
- Funding community agricultural development projects, Battambang.
- Funding literacy program, Battambang.
- Funding emergency rice distribution, Battambang.
1995-2003
- Funding orphanage, Bak Chan, greater Phnom Penh.
- Funding AIDS hospice, Bak Chan, greater Phnom Penh.
- Funding agricultural training center, Bak Chan, greater Phnom Penh.
1997-1999
- Building floating medical clinic, Phlouck, Siem Reap.
- Funding emergency rice distribution, Siem Reap.
2000-2003
- Funding public health program, Touk Kleang, Kandal Province.
- Funding river based medical evacuation program, Mekong River, Kandal Province.
- Building medical clinic, Touk Kleang, Kandal Province.
- Building orphanage, Kampong Speu.
- Funding literacy program, Mondul Kiri.
2001
- Funding AIDS medical home care program, Kampong Cham.
2002-2004
- Funding elder community support program, Sok Sen, Kandal Province.
- Funding community school, Sok Sen, Kandal Province.
- Funding widows skill training program, Sok Sen, Kandal Province.
- Funding prison program for women, location - several prisons.
- Funding prison literacy and skills program - prison CC3.
- Funding disabled children treatment program, Phnom Penh.
- Building school sanitation system, Lvea, Battambang.
2003-2005
- Building Poipet Hospital.
- Supply of ambulances for the greater Poipet area.
- Building orphanage, Kampong Speu.
